On  4-Mar-2009, Jaroslav Hajek wrote:

| I agree it would be more useful, as they really are special kind of
| sparse matrices.
| But it would break backward and Matlab compatibility in a fairly
| invasive way (infinitely more than the recently discussed NaN issues),
| so I think a wide agreement is really necessary here.

OK, if we don't make diag x sparse matrices retain the sparsity, then
what method do we have that allows row or column scaling of a sparse
matrix (for example) which preserves sparsity?  The modified version
of dmult did that, correct?  I think that's what Jason was complaining
about (correct me if I'm wrong).
